Thirteen fashion and beauty pitches sit in our files, and every one of them left the Den with a deal. Eight had their terms disclosed on air; five did not. It is a notably modern shelf, with nothing here older than season 10.
What links the recent entries is how little equity these founders let go of. Skinny Tan gave up 10% for Β£60,000, while both Faace and Mystery Jersey King parted with just 15%, each pricing the business well above the category's Β£120,000 ceiling on cash. Beach Powder is the counterweight, handing over 49%.
